Location:
The property is located on Summer Hill Road in the Jewellery Quarter area of Birmingham, situated close to the junction with Sand Pits and the A457 Dudley Road. Birmingham City Centre lies approximately 0.5 miles to the south-east, providing access to a range of retail, leisure, and transport facilities. The location benefits from good transport links, with Jewellery Quarter Train and Metro Station situated approximately 0.4 miles away, offering direct connections to Birmingham Snow Hill and the wider West Midlands rail network. The surrounding road network provides easy access to the A4540 Inner Ring Road and the A38(M) Aston Expressway, linking to Junction 6 of the M6 Motorway and the wider national motorway network.
Description:
The property comprises a substantial former industrial building of traditional brick construction, arranged over ground and upper floors, situated on a self-contained site fronting Summer Hill Road in the Jewellery Quarter area of Birmingham. The premises were previously in commercial use and now require comprehensive refurbishment throughout. Internally, the accommodation is largely stripped back to shell condition, offering an open layout suitable for redevelopment. Externally, the property features period elevations with original architectural detailing and a pitched roof structure.

Planning:
Planning permission has been granted for the change of use, conversion and extension of the existing building to provide 26 residential apartments and a 12-bed apart-hotel, together with associated works and parking.
Planning Application Reference: 2022/08104/PA.
